<p>This book systematically studies the development of desert and mountain ecosystems in Kazakhstan from the western Caspian Sea coast to the eastern Balkhash Lake region. The contents include: desert agricultural development (taking the lower reaches of the Syr Darya River as an example), industrial area layout planning, desertification assessment in the Aral Sea region, research on the hydrochemical characteristics of Balkhash Lake, analysis of the avalanche formation mechanism of the Tianshan Mountains, and suggestions for optimizing the network of nature reserves in East Kazakhstan. Pay special attention to natural resource management and ecological protection in extreme environments, providing important reference for arid area geography, environmental ecology and regional development planning. </p>
